Going for the Deep Pockets

 

By Elton Camp

 

Too many lawyers seeking somebody to sue

From doctors & hospitals feel a living is due

 

So doctors and nurses are forced into CYA

For needless tests the patients then must pay

 

A doctor would surely be a most careless sort

Who didn’t ask, “How will this look in court?”

 

The lawyer who an ambulance used to chase

Is the same one who loves the doctors to face

 

Malpractice insurance has pockets so deep

But it makes the doctor’s fees terribly steep

 

So all he can do is charge patients more

So such lawyers we all should simply abhor

 

In rare cases, a doctor is guilty as can be

A malpractice suit there I can actually see

 

But medical practice is surely an inexact art

And most such actions should never start

 

For what some lawyers do absolutely isn’t right

Such a one is nothing but an economic parasite
